Public Health programs often use multimedia messages to build awareness and readiness among populations to promote their engagement in making positive health decisions.
The Healthy Hive’s work is no different.
Hive members play an active role in the creation of health messages used to promote access to medically accurate information about sexual and reproductive health. Not only do they curate messages for their peers, but they develop messages for parents/caregivers and other youth-supporting adults.
Campaign messages are meant to encourage youth and their parents/caregivers to have conversations about sexual and reproductive health through sharing trusted information about how to have those difficult conversations.
Similarly, the campaign helps to promote local supportive services for youth and their parents.
